In fact with an avistar you most likely will need to go to all the way idle on the downwind leg before you turn back to the runway.
At the end of the runway going the other way, cut the idle and let it coast a sec or two then make your turn and you should be in good shape. You can add a touch of power if needed but usually I just stick it in from there on idle.
Remember on an electric if you pull it all the way back the prop isn't turning and productin zero thrust, on a glow engine even at idle the engine is turning around 2000+ rpm and with a 10" or 11" prop that's still some thrust coming out of it.
